KEY TAKEAWAYS

  • How often do you measure yourself against your goals?
    • Going back to what we’ve discussed in the previous episode, the Goal Pyramid, try to review each layer several times. You can check them daily, weekly, or quarterly – whatever works for you. Regarding frequency, you might want to check the top layer less relative to how you measure the middle and bottom layers so you won’t get demotivated.
  • If you are doing the actions and still not meeting your milestones, review your timetable, remind yourself about your WHY, and go back to the previous steps if needed.
“Beyond its meaning, FOCUS is also an acronym. It stands for Follow One Course Until Successful.
  • Along with your to-do list, create a NOT-to-do list. The first thing you have to do is create a list of everything that you think you need to do. Then, pick the top 3 most important things and put them on another list – your to-do list.
    • If you’re done with the top 3 things, go back to the things you haven’t picked – your not-to-do list – to pick your next top 3.
    • Your not-to-do list is a great reminder, so you don’t get to spread yourself too thin. Those are what you shouldn’t be prioritizing yet not to get derailed from being successful.
